Question 1041784: The following letters represent a series. What letter do you think comes next?
I, O, V, F, X, T, L, F, M, _

I, O, V, F, X, T, L, F, M, _
   The Roman numeral for 1 is I. 
     and "one" starts with an O.
   The Roman numeral for 5 is V. 
    and "five" starts with an F.
  The Roman numeral for 10 is X. 
      and "ten" starts with a T.
  The Roman numeral for 50 is L. 
   and "fifty" starts with an F.

The Roman numeral for 1000 is M. 
 and "thousand" starts with a T.

But I can't help but wonder why they skipped C for 100,
and went from L for 50 all the way to M for 1000.
They were in order of the letters used I,V,X,L, but next
should have been C followed by H.  But they skipped those.
That's why I left those two rows blank.  They should be

 The Roman numeral for 100 is C. 
 and "hundred" starts with an H.
